In-Depth Review

Introduction

The Wilson Bela LT V2.5 2024 is a lightweight diamond-shaped racket that suits advanced players seeking control and speed.

Shape & Balance

The diamond shape shifts balance toward the head, giving more weight behind your swings. This helps with power but can feel less stable on off-center hits.

You'll notice the head-heavy feel on volleys, where it adds punch. It also assists in overheads, but you need control over the swing to keep shots in.

Grip

The standard grip fits comfortably without slipping, even when hands sweat. The handle length is standard, giving a solid base for both hands.

After a long match, your arm won't tire as much because the racket is light. That's a plus for players who rely on quick reactions.

Power & Control

The power score of 7.5 is solid but not explosive. You get enough momentum for smashes, but you'll need to swing harder to end points.

Control at 9 is where this racket shines. The carbon fiber faces provide rigidity, letting you direct shots with precision. It's a control-first tool that rewards placement over brute force.

Comfort & Speed

The soft EVA core absorbs shock, making long rallies comfortable on the arm. The medium feel gives a balance between stiffness and flex, reducing harsh vibrations.

Its maneuverability score of 8.9 means it moves quickly through the air. That's great for defensive play and fast net exchanges, where you need to change directions instantly.

Materials & Durability

Both frame and faces are carbon fiber, which is durable and holds up well to aggressive play. It resists cracking and keeps its shape over time.

The EVA soft core adds a touch of flexibility, which helps absorb impacts. While soft cores last, avoid hitting walls or rough surfaces—no racket survives that.

Analysis

This racket feels lighter than its specs suggest, making it easy to handle at the net. The diamond shape gives extra head weight for reaching balls without sacrificing swing speed.

The soft EVA core and carbon fiber faces deliver a medium feel that absorbs vibration well. You get clear feedback on every shot, which helps with placement.

With control at 9/10, you can drop the ball precisely into corners. However, power is solid at 7.5, so you'll need to generate pace on your own—it's not a free power stick.

The maneuverability rating of 8.9 shows in quick exchanges and defensive lobs. The sweet spot is high at 8.9, forgiving off-center hits more than typical diamonds.

Beginners or players who want easy power should look elsewhere. This racket demands good technique to unlock its full potential.

Verdict

If you're an intermediate to advanced player who values control and quick handling, this racket is a solid pick. It suits a precise, defensive style that punishes mistakes.

Steer clear if you're a beginner or if you rely on raw power. Heavier, power-oriented rackets will serve you better. The Bela LT is about finesse, not force.

Frequently asked questions

Who is the Wilson Bela LT V2.5 2024 for? Can beginners use it?

This racket suits advanced or intermediate players who have solid technique. Beginners might struggle because it lacks free power, but if you practice, it rewards control.

Is the Wilson Bela LT V2.5 2024 a power or control racket?

It's more control-oriented with a 9/10 control score. Power is solid at 7.5, so you get some punch, but it's not a heavy-hitter. Players who want predictable shots will like it.

Is the Wilson Bela LT V2.5 2024 comfortable on the elbow?

Yes, the soft EVA core and medium feel absorb a lot of vibration, so it's kind to the elbow. The light weight also reduces strain, making it good for matches where you're on court for hours.
